My car smokes a lot while warming up (It looks like theres a small fire or something coming from my exhaust). The smoke is white which would make me think its coolent but its not. The coolent level in both the radiator and overflow have not gone down at all over two weeks. Its not fuel because it doesnt smell at all. Its not oil cause the smoke isnt blue and the oil level hasnt gone down at all either. Its driving me nuts cause I cant figure it out... I do have a gutted cat but it had the same problem before but not this bad. Any ideas/advice would be great, thx.

Well, float6969 asked the question, my opinion is if your car only does it on warm up, your valve seals are toasted, it doesnt take much of oil "few drops" to make it to the combustion chamber and you will see a cloud of smoke, which it will not effect the oil level almost at all, as it only needs few drops.

Could be either dealing with a failing headgasket or crappy turbo! Oil seals smoke only momentarily and doesn't smoke that heavily in the morning or after the car has been sitting for a while. I think it's more of a coolant issue when the words "White smoke" is mentioned.

Keep in mind the fact that your turbos are not brand new! Once the cartridge shatters, it will let some oil and water into the back housing, which will in turn cause these smoking conditions. If you want the smoke to stop, disconnect and block-off your water lines to your turbocharger.
